Why Does Apple Juice Not Have Fiber? The Science Behind the Missing Nutrient

5 min read

A medium-sized, unpeeled apple contains over 4 grams of dietary fiber, but a typical glass of clear commercial apple juice has virtually none. The simple reason why does apple juice not have fiber lies in the industrial manufacturing process, which is designed to extract a clear, shelf-stable liquid from the fruit.

The Commercial Juicing Process: A Step-by-Step Breakdown

Commercial apple juice production is a multi-step process engineered for efficiency and consistency, but it comes at the expense of dietary fiber. Understanding this journey from whole fruit to filtered beverage reveals precisely where the fiber is lost.

1. Washing and Crushing

First, freshly harvested apples are thoroughly washed and sorted to remove any dirt or blemishes. Next, they are sent through a grinder that chops them into a mash or pulp. This initial step releases the fruit's natural juices and prepares it for pressing.

2. Pressing and Extraction

Once crushed, the pulp is pressed, typically using large, rotating shafts or hydraulic presses. This step squeezes out the liquid juice, separating it from the remaining solid material, known as pomace. The pomace, which is primarily composed of the apple's skin, seeds, and fibrous flesh, contains the vast majority of the fruit's dietary fiber. In commercial operations, this pomace is often discarded or repurposed, not used in the final juice product.

3. Enzymatic Treatment and Clarification

To achieve the perfectly clear, shimmering juice that consumers expect, the extracted liquid undergoes a clarification process. This involves treating the juice with pectin-degrading enzymes that break down the cellular structure and prevent the development of cloudiness. This crucial step further reduces any remaining fiber, pulp, and other suspended solids, leading to a smooth, transparent liquid. The enzyme-treated juice is then filtered again, sometimes using gelatin or other fining agents, to polish it to a crystal-clear finish.

4. Pasteurization and Concentration

The final stages involve pasteurization, a heating process that kills bacteria and extends shelf life, and often, concentration. In concentration, water is removed to reduce shipping and storage costs. Later, water is added back during reconstitution. While this process ensures food safety and convenience, it does not add back the lost fiber or nutrients.

The Crucial Role of Fiber in Whole Apples

Fiber is a type of carbohydrate that the body cannot digest. In a whole apple, it exists in two forms, each providing distinct health benefits, all of which are missing in clear juice.

Soluble vs. Insoluble Fiber

  • Soluble fiber, like the pectin found in apples, dissolves in water to form a gel-like substance. This slows digestion, which helps manage blood sugar levels and can lower cholesterol.
  • Insoluble fiber, found in the apple's skin, adds bulk to stool. This helps promote regular bowel movements and prevents constipation.

Satiety and Digestive Health

Eating a whole apple provides a sense of fullness that drinking its juice does not. The fiber and bulk of the fruit take up space in the stomach and slow down the rate at which it empties. This process, along with the act of chewing, signals to the brain that you are full, which is beneficial for managing weight. Conversely, without fiber, apple juice is quickly consumed, and the liquid calories do little to promote satiety.

The Nutritional Impact of Fiber Removal

The absence of fiber in commercial apple juice has significant nutritional consequences, fundamentally changing how the body processes the fruit's natural sugars.

Sugar Spikes vs. Steady Energy

Unlike the natural sugars in a whole apple, which are released slowly due to the presence of fiber, the concentrated sugars in apple juice are rapidly absorbed into the bloodstream. This causes a quick spike in blood sugar, followed by a potential crash. This rapid fluctuation is concerning for individuals with prediabetes or diabetes and can lead to energy crashes and cravings.

Reduced Satiety and Weight Management

Because liquid calories are less filling, it is easy to overconsume apple juice. A single glass might contain the concentrated sugar of several apples, but without the fiber to make you feel full, you can drink a large quantity quickly and consume more calories than you would by eating the whole fruit. Over time, this contributes to increased calorie intake and potential weight gain.

Whole Fruit vs. Juice: A Nutritional Comparison

Feature Whole Apple (medium, unpeeled) Commercial Clear Apple Juice (1 cup/8 oz)
Dietary Fiber 4.4 g 0 g
Sugar ~19 g (intrinsic) ~24 g (free)
Calories ~95 ~115
Absorption Slow, moderated by fiber Rapid, leading to blood sugar spikes
Satiety High, promotes feeling of fullness Low, easy to overconsume
Pulp and Skin Included, rich in antioxidants and fiber Removed during filtering

Alternative Juicing Methods that Retain Fiber

For those who prefer liquid forms of apples but want the benefits of fiber, there are alternative methods to consider.

Cloudy or Unfiltered Juice

Some producers offer cloudy or unfiltered apple juice, which skips the fine-filtering stage. As the name suggests, this juice is opaque and contains more pulp and, consequently, more dietary fiber and polyphenols than its clear counterpart. This is a healthier option than standard clear juice, though it still contains less fiber than a whole apple.

Blending vs. Juicing

Blending a whole apple in a blender, rather than using a juicer, preserves all the fiber. A smoothie made with a whole apple and its skin will retain all the soluble and insoluble fiber. While the fiber is broken down into smaller pieces during blending, its presence still aids digestion and slows sugar absorption, offering a nutritional profile closer to that of the whole fruit.
